I'm setting aside a non-park night to have dinner & check out Xmas decorations at Wilderness Lodge and then from there attend the Campfire program at the Ft Wilderness campground.
How would we get there from the Poly? and back?

Thank you
 
When is your trip?? If it is in the near future, you can walk to the TTC from the Poly, then take a bus over to Wilderness Lodge. (This is because there is current construction at the MK bus stop that requires the Wilderness Lodge bus to run to the TTC.)

From the Wilderness Lodge to Ft. Wilderness you can take a boat over, or take the walking path over (about 20 minutes).

To get back to the Poly, if the Magic Kingdom is still open, you can take a boat to Magic Kingdom or the Contemporary, then take the monorail to the Poly.

OR take a bus to TTC from the Settlement bus stop, then walk to the Poly.
 
There is also boat service to both WL and Fort Wilderness from the Contemporary. Monorail to Contemporary and then boat to destination. Smaller boats than the option above but still workable if you do not have strollers.

Settlement is one of the 2 main FW bus stops(outpost is the other and not important for your purposes). Once you are at WL there is a bus that will take you to FW and to the proper stop for the campfire show. It picks up at the WL bus area and says FW, once it is in FW it changes to a FW orange bus, tell the driver that you want to go to the campfire show and the will tell you when your stop comes up. After the show, walk back to the bus stop and wait for the bus that says Settlement. Walk from the Settlement bus stop to the boat dock(if the boats are still running, check park hours)take the boat to the MK, it is enclosed and will be warmer than the CR boat. If the MK is closed, that will not be a viable route. Check with the FW bus drivers to find the best way to DTD or another park that is open. If all parks are closed DTD is the only transfer point to go from resort to resort.
